Last week I went back to the surgeon yet again hoping for some answers. He told me I basically had two choices - live with the pain or to have a periacetabular osteotomy (PAO), which was what he recommended over a year ago. It was only my uneasiness with that procedure that led me to have arthroscopy instead. However, I have yet to be pain-free following that surgery, and it really feels like I have torn the cartilage again. If I had to live with the pain, it's not that bad, usually not much more than 2 on a scale of 1 to 10. But I don't want the joint to wear out prematurely. The surgeon thinks it already has mild arthritis but is confident that I will have a great outcome with the PAO.

So I will lose part of another summer with the hope of enjoying many summer and winter activities without pain in the future.
